Comparing Argentina with Indio, California

Compare Climate information for Argentina and Indio, California

Is Argentina warmer or hotter than Indio, California?

On average across the year, no, Argentina is not hotter than Indio, California . Argentina has an average temperature of 18°C/64°F and Indio, California has an average temperature of 23°C/73°F.

Argentina's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is not hotter than Indio, California's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 42°C/108°F).

Is Argentina colder or cooler than Indio, California?

On average across the year, yes, Argentina is colder than Indio, California . Argentina has an average minimum temperature of 12°C/54°F and Indio, California has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F.



Argentina's coldest month is July, with an average minimum temperature of 4°C/39°F, which is not colder than Indio, California's coldest month (December, with an average minimum temperature of 3°C/37°F).

Does Argentina have more rain than Indio, California?

On average across the year, yes, Argentina has more rain than Indio, California. Argentina has an average annual rainfall of 499mm and Indio, California has an average annual rainfall of 69mm.

Argentina's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 78mm, which is wetter than Indio, California's wettest month (also January, with an average monthly rainfall of 12mm).
